Florida International vs. New Mexico State Prediction, Odds, Picks - October 29, 2024
Oddsmakers give the Florida International Panthers (2-6) the edge when they host the New Mexico State Aggies (2-5) on Tuesday, October 29, 2024 in a matchup between CUSA foes at Riccardo Silva Stadium. Florida International is favored by 9.5 points. The over/under is set at 43.5.
The Panthers lost to the Sam Houston Bearkats, 10-7, in their last contest. The Aggies beat the Louisiana Tech Bulldogs, 33-30, in their most recent contest.

Florida International vs. New Mexico State Betting Insights
- Per the spread and over/under, the implied score for the game is Panthers 26, Aggies 17.
- The Panthers have a 78.3% chance to collect the win in this contest per the moneyline's implied probability. The Aggies hold a 26.4% implied probability.
- Florida International has compiled a 5-2-0 record against the spread this season.
- New Mexico State has won two games against the spread this season.
Florida International vs. New Mexico State: Head-to-Head
- Florida International and New Mexico State have been matched up evenly over their last two games, sharing the same 1-1 record.
- The two teams have gone over the total on one occasion while sharing a split 1-1 record in their games against the spread.
- Over their last two head-to-head matchups, New Mexico State has racked up 41 points, while Florida International has tallied 38.
